Conversely, when an export parity price is calculated as shown in Table 4, all marketing<br />
costs are subtracted. These therefore result into a large difference between the import<br />
and export parity prices. If all marketing costs are subtracted, the price that the farmer<br />
can expect at the warehouse gate is R7472.3 per ton <strong>of</strong> <strong>tea</strong> and is much lower<br />
compared to the import parity price. However, this price would still be attractive to<br />
farmers as it can generate pr<strong>of</strong>its that are comparable with those <strong>of</strong> other competing<br />
<strong>tea</strong>s like rooibos.<br />
